public interface AuthApi
| Modifier and Type | Method and Description |
|---|---|
io.reactivex.rxjava3.core.Single<UserSensitiveInfoResponse> |
getUserDetail(UserTicket userTicket)
获取访问用户敏感信息,需要授权scope包含
snsapi_privateinfo |
io.reactivex.rxjava3.core.Single<UserDetailResponse> |
getUserInfo(String code)
获取访问用户身份
|
@GET(value="auth/getuserinfo") io.reactivex.rxjava3.core.Single<UserDetailResponse> getUserInfo(@Query(value="code") String code)
该接口用于根据code获取成员信息,适用于自建应用与代开发应用
code - 通过成员授权获取到的code@POST(value="auth/getuserdetail") io.reactivex.rxjava3.core.Single<UserSensitiveInfoResponse> getUserDetail(@Body UserTicket userTicket)
snsapi_privateinfo
自建应用与代开发应用可通过该接口获取成员授权的敏感字段
userTicket - 成员票据Copyright © 2023. All rights reserved.